Can Splunk v. 9.1 Enterprise run on an AWS EC2 t2.micro with the standard 8GB?  When I run the query, index="_internal" | STATS count by host, I get an error saying the minimum 5000(thousand)MB is not met.  Thanks for all your help.

Hi

it depends what you are doing. If just testing wit only some inputs and one or two user it’s doable, but you need to wait many times to get results to your queries. For any reasonable use, I said that 4-6 core is minimum and splunk’s own recommendations are much higher.  

That warning is meaning that splunk db has less than 5GiB disk base. Usually splunk db is under /opt/splunk/var. Just check it and add more disk base or move SPLUNK_DB to somewhere where are enough space. Docs has good instructions how to do it
